试题详情: 从键盘上输入两个任意整数(两个整数间以逗号分隔),分别保存在x和y变量中,交换两个变量中的值后进行输出。 输入提示: 输入两个任意整数(两个整数间以逗号分隔)。 输出提示: 交换两个变量中的值后进行输出(两个整数间以逗号分隔)。 输入样本: 5,9 输出样本: 9,5
时间: 2023-05-28 14:04:48 浏览: 104
x,y = input().split(',')
x = int(x)
y = int(y)
# 方法一:使用第三个变量
# temp = x
# x = y
# y = temp
# 方法二:不使用第三个变量
# x,y = y,x
print(str(y) + ',' + str(x))
相关问题
输入两个整数并保存到变量a和b中,请交换两个变量的值并输出。 输入格式: 输入两个整数,中间用一个空格分隔。 输出格式: 按照样例输出两个变量的值,中间用逗号分隔。
好的,这是一个编程问题。请看以下代码:
```python
a, b = input().split()
a, b = int(a), int(b)
a, b = b, a
print(a, b, sep=',')
```
输入两个整数,程序将它们分别赋值给变量a和b。然后,使用Python的多重赋值语法交换变量的值。最后,使用print函数输出交换后的变量值,中间用逗号分隔。
希望这个回答能够帮到你!
输入两个整数并保存到变量 a 和 b 中,请交换两个变量的值并输出。 输入格式: 输入两个整数,中间用一个空格分隔。 输出格式: 按照样例输出两个变量的值,中间用逗号分隔。
好的,我可以回答这个问题。请看以下代码:
#include <stdio.h>
int main() {
int a, b, temp;
scanf("%d %d", &a, &b);
temp = a;
a = b;
b = temp;
printf("%d,%d", a, b);
return ;
}
输入两个整数,程序会将它们保存到变量 a 和 b 中。然后,程序使用一个临时变量 temp 来交换 a 和 b 的值。最后,程序输出交换后的 a 和 b 的值,中间用逗号分隔。
阅读全文